Drone archaeology is a cutting-edge field that combines the marvels of modern technology with the intrigue of ancient history. By utilizing drones equipped with high-resolution cameras and LiDAR technology, researchers can discover and document archaeological sites in ways never before possible.
One of the key benefits of drone archaeology is the ability to survey large areas quickly and efficiently. Drones can cover vast expanses of land in a fraction of the time it would take a team of researchers on foot. This speed and efficiency make it possible to discover new sites and gain insights into existing ones more rapidly.
Drone technology is revolutionizing the field of archaeology by providing new perspectives and data that were previously inaccessible. Drones can create detailed 3D maps of sites, identify buried structures, and even reveal patterns in the landscape that are invisible from the ground. This wealth of information helps archaeologists piece together the puzzle of the past with greater accuracy.
While drone archaeology offers many advantages, it also comes with its own set of challenges. Weather conditions, regulatory restrictions, and technical issues can all impact the success of a drone survey. Additionally, the interpretation of drone data requires specialized skills and expertise to ensure accurate analysis and meaningful results.
